JOB TITLE: Program Specialist, Teacher Education & Curriculum Development


LOCATION: History Center - 345 W Kellogg Blvd., St. Paul, MN 55102

 

COMPENSATION: Typical starting range $59,092.80 - $63,648.00 annually


STATUS & HOURS: Full-time, project position through June 30, 2027. Typical schedule is Monday through Friday, 9-5 with opportunity for some hybrid. Occasional evenings and weekends for special events.


BENEFITS:  Eligible to participate in State Employee Group Insurance Program and a retirement program with employer contribution. Generous vacation and sick time accruals with additional paid holidays.


DESIGNATION: Bargaining Unit AFSCME Local 3173


POSTING DATE: November 12, 2025


DEADLINE DATE: November 26, 2025

TO APPLY: Interested applicants must apply online at the Minnesota Historical Society’s career center at www.mnhs.org/jobs and include a resume and cover letter by the application deadline date.  



DESCRIPTION:  To coordinate the development, design, and production necessary to ensure the successful, on-time, within-budget completion of all Northern Lights 3rd Edition components. The Program Specialist also proactively facilitates open, timely, and consistent communication and collaboration within the Northern Lights 3rd Edition project team, between this team and MNHS staff and stakeholders beyond MNHS, and with outside vendors/contractors.


SUMMARY OF WORK:  1) Work closely with the Program Manager of Teacher Education and Curriculum Development and the Northern Lights 3rd Edition Development Team to implement the development plan to complete all Northern Lights 3rd Edition components efficiently and cost-effectively, while maintaining high-quality production; 2) Provide financial management for the Northern Lights 3rd Edition project; 3) Foster effective communication throughout the Northern Lights 3rd Edition development project; and 4) Initiate and maintain a file and data management and tracking system.


M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Bachelor’s degree in education, history, humanities, business, organizational management, English/literature/journalism/publishing, or a related field, or equivalent experience.

  • Four years of experience in one or more of the degree field(s) listed above, in particular project management or publishing, professional sales, education, or classroom teaching.

  • Results-oriented, with a demonstrated ability to work both independently and within a team environment.

  • A resourceful self-starter with aptitude for problem-solving and the ability to make strategic judgments.

  • Strong oral, writing, presentation, and interpersonal skills. 

  • Demonstrated ability to work with diverse groups and individuals.

  • Demonstrated ability to multitask, work effectively under pressure to meet deadlines, prioritize, and adapt to changing priorities.

  • Demonstrated ability to think imaginatively and problem-solve.

  • Familiarity with computer applications such as Google Suite, Microsoft, Munis Finance, and/or comfortable with learning and using new software applications.

  • Ability and willingness to travel locally and throughout Minnesota.

  • Valid driver’s license.


DESIRED Q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Master’s degree in education, history, humanities, business, organizational management, English/literature/journalism/publishing or related field.

  • Familiarity with current educational standards and the structure of education delivery in Minnesota.

  • Experience with K-12 classrooms, teaching practices, and/or curriculum content.

  • General knowledge of Minnesota and US history and social studies education.

  • Demonstrated ability to project manage complex, multi-pronged projects with many stakeholders and numerous business vendors. 

  • Deep knowledge of print and/or digital publishing.

  • Familiarity with non-profit organizations in general and with the Minnesota Historical Society specifically, including book publishing and K-12 products.
